Summary

Episode 9 looks at how the Kinahans took over an Irish prison - and what its locked up foot soldiers did next.


With vast fortunes on the tables from the Americans, are any Cartel top brass willing to snitch on Daniel?


This is the story of how the Kinahans are sailing close to US winds, with President Donald Trump vowing “obliteration” for drugs cartels.


Plus, where can they go now, with the world closing in on them, and the Irish authorities ready to push the button on an extradition warrant?


We hear how Dubai is cleaning house, booting out mobsters from Italy, Ireland, Holland, Turkey and Scotland.
